Book Description
APIs power modern web applications, but traditional REST often lacks flexibility and scalability. GraphQL changes that by offering a faster, more efficient way to fetch and manage data. Ultimate GraphQL for Scalable Web Apps takes you from core concepts to production-ready apps, helping you build real-world, high-performance web applications with confidence.
Through the hands-on creation of Streamify, a Netflix-style streaming platform, you can master the complete GraphQL ecosystem using Node.js, Express, Apollo Server, MongoDB, React, and Apollo Client. From designing schemas and writing efficient queries to building authentication systems and recommendation engines, every concept is grounded in real-world development.
This is not a theory-heavy manual. It is a practical, project-driven guide. Each chapter builds on real implementation, helping you craft an admin panel, design a compelling interface, implement rating systems, and develop intelligent recommendations. You will confront production challenges head-on, solving the N+1 query problem with DataLoader, implementing advanced caching for performance, and architecting scalable backends for real-world traffic.
